Problems solved by technology

[0008] The structure of the above two patent applications can basically complete the inductance sorting of the magnetic ring, but in the test use, it is all done manually. For each test, the metal cover needs to be removed from the metal column, and then the to-be-separated Put the magnetic ring on the annular insulating cover or the annular insulating cover, then close the metal cover, test and record, and finally take out the metal cover and the tested magnetic ring in the reverse order, etc. The operation steps are cumbersome, back and forth, and test The cycle is long and the efficiency is low. After a long test, the tester's hand will feel sore and swollen
In addition, manual testing and reading, the test error is large

Abstract

The invention discloses an on-line automatic separation method for inductance of a small-inductance magnet ring. The method comprises steps of installing an on-line automatic separation device for the inductance of the small-inductance magnet ring, setting testing parameters, carrying out debugging, forming a standard magnetic ring sealed space, forming a closed magnetic access, separating inductance, resetting a metal cover and a test base and the like, wherein the on-line automatic separation device for the inductance of the small-inductance magnet ring comprises a multi-interval rotary disk with a plurality of through holes, the test base, a jacking device, an inductance tester, an automatic feeding device, a discharging device and an integration control panel in which a PLC (programmable logic controller) is arranged. A circular insulation block is arranged in each through hole of the multi-interval rotary disk, and the circular insulation block not only can bear the weight of the magnetic ring to be separated, but also serves as part of the standard magnetic ring sealed space. According to the method, in the whole inductance separation process, the automation degree is high; manual work is not required; the test speed is high; the efficiency is high; and the test data are accurate and reliable.

technical field [0001] The invention relates to a magnetic ring inductance sorting method, in particular to a small inductance magnetic ring inductance online automatic sorting method. Background technique [0002] After the production of magnetic products is completed, it is necessary to test the magnetic products to check whether the magnetic products are qualified and provide data support for future process improvement. [0003] For the inductance test of toroidal cores, especially for magnetic devices with small inductance, such as nickel-zinc ferrite cores with small inductance, the unit of single-turn inductance is nH level, and the existing inductance tester basically cannot directly test it. [0004] In order to test its inductance and avoid instrument and test errors, the existing technology is to wind a multi-turn coil on the magnetic core to be tested, usually more than 50 turns, and use peripheral testing instruments to read the inductance value.
